Panoramic view of Kutahya (Kutahia) a city in western Turkey lying on the Porsuk river - the capital of Kutahya Province. Under the reign of Byzantine Emperor Justinian I the town was fortified with a double-line of walls and citadel (as shown here in the background) Date: circa 1920s
